Stories Related to Duryea Resident Commissions As Officer In Us Army

Stephen Starinsky, the son of Janine and Steve Starinsky, Duryea, has commissioned into the United States Army as a second lieutenant and will serve as a field artillery officer. He was named a George C. Marshall Award winner and a Distinguished Military Graduate by graduating in the top 5% of all ROTC Cadets across the country.
